Unsafe Condition

The ingestion of an excessive amount of water through the inlet barrier filter element results in an engine failure, which is an unsafe condition.

Required Actions

Within 30 days, revise the rotorcraft flight manual supplement by inserting Appendix A of this AD into the limitations section. If the filter medium has moisture during the preflight inspection, or if the rotorcraft is operating in heavy precipitation, open the bypass doors if equipped. When operating in precipitation, sudden and rapid power transients should be avoided whenever practical.

Affected Aircraft

Airbus Helicopters Model AS350B, AS350B1, AS350B2, AS350B3, and AS350BA helicopters with a Pall Aerospace Corporation inlet barrier filter element.
